This guide is going to cover the questline for Sparky the robot in the Dark Horizon DLC. Completing this quest will reward you with the Redeemer pistol, along with various rings and amulets.

Finding Sparky

To start, you need to find Sparky, who appears in the Outer Ring or Overworld 1 of the Dark Horizon DLC. It’s unclear whether Sparky has a random spawn location initially, but once you interact with it for the first time, it will move around randomly across the maps. You can spot it on your mini-map as an NPC marker.

Interacting with Sparky

Equip the Phetyr Armor before speaking to Sparky. This armor triggers unique dialogue in which Sparky believes you are supposed to destroy it for malfunctioning. While it’s uncertain if wearing the armor is mandatory to continue the questline, it does alter the dialogue, suggesting that it might be necessary.

When talking to Sparky, tell it that you are from a different planet and that you can bring it back to Earth. Be sure to correct it when it says “Orth” instead of “Earth” to ensure it doesn’t get lost. After this interaction, Sparky will begin appearing at different locations as you progress through Dark Horizon. Each time you zone into a new area, you may encounter Sparky again, but the dialogue will mostly repeat itself.

Locating Sparky After the Final Boss

Once you have defeated the final boss, you will be able to find Sparky in the Inner Ring or Overworld 2 of the map, in the area called Waylade Conservatory within the Withered Necropolis. From the first World Stone, head left, use the glider to reach a platform in the middle of the area, clear out the enemies, and you will see the Warden Armor on the left. Sparky will be in the top-right corner of the area.

You may need to speak to Sparky multiple times before it wakes up. If Sparky does not wake up, it could be because you did not repair the hanging prototype robot or did not defeat both bosses in your playthrough. While it’s unclear whether these tasks are required, it is recommended to clear all objectives before facing the final boss to avoid issues.

Returning to the Ward and Obtaining the Alloy Extractor

After speaking to Sparky and telling it to return to Earth, you will find it in the Ward next to Dwell. At this point, Sparky will give you a new item called the Alloy Extractor. This item allows you to collect new Alloys from different planets, including N’Erud, Loam, and Yesa. These materials can be farmed by defeating enemies at any difficulty level. You can identify them easily on your mini-map, as they will appear as purple ion drops.

To progress further, you will need about 100 of each Alloy type, so be prepared to farm World Drops extensively.

Sparky’s New Role and Item Trade-Ins

Sparky essentially functions as Nightweaver’s Web 2.0, allowing you to trade quest items and new materials for various rings and amulets. Thankfully, you do not need to be in Campaign Mode to collect these items—you can find them in any Adventure Mode run and return to the Ward to exchange them with Sparky.

There are nine quest items required for trade-ins. For reference, check the description below (if applicable) to locate them. Once you have gathered the necessary items and Alloys, you can trade them for three amulets and six rings.

Receiving the Redeemer Pistol

After completing all trade-ins, Sparky will thank you and reward you with the Redeemer pistol. This unique handgun fires relics as part of its mod ability, making it a powerful support weapon.
